Relative Pulse Outputs and Absolute Pulse Outputs
Selecting Relative or
Absolute Coordinates
The pulse output PV's coordinate system (absolute or relative) is selected
automatically, as follows:
• When the origin is undetermined, the system operates in relative coordi-
nates.
• When the origin has been determined, the system operates in absolute
coordinates.
